Getting Your Motorcycle Driving License in New York

If you're a seasoned rider or new to the sport, getting your motorcycle license opens up a new world of possibilities. The process varies by state and state, but typically includes the written test, riding practice, and a road exam.

In certain situations, you could be able to skip both the written test and the road test if you enroll in a training program. These courses aren't cheap.

How to Get a Motorcycle License

New York residents who are keen to take a ride on a motorbike should familiarize themselves with the requirements and fees involved in getting a license. Knowing these requirements can assist you in navigating the licensing process smoothly and avoid costly errors.

The first step to obtain a motorcycle license is passing the written test. The test covers a wide range of topics that range from basic safety for motorcycles to riding techniques and regulations. It is recommended to read the guideline for the written test prior to taking it. You can get a copy of the manual on the DMV website or at the local library.

After passing the written test, you will need to pass a road skills test. During this test, you will be required to show the ability to control your motorcycle at different speeds and maneuvers. Based on the regulations of your state you could be required to complete a safety course. The course usually runs over two days and consists of video, classroom and written instruction. Some schools even offer weekend courses for working professionals.

If you're ready to take the road test, you should practice with a licensed motorcycle rider who will accompany you throughout the test. It is also important to keep your bike in good working order and be able perform regular maintenance. Also, make sure your helmet is up to current and in compliance with federal standards.

It is also recommended to bring all the required documents when you visit the DMV. This includes proof of age, residence and identity. You'll need the original documents, a photo and the online Permit Test Parent/Guardian Certification.

In some instances you may be eligible for a waiver for the road test if you complete an approved Motorcycle Rider Education Course. These classes are taught by private and public schools across the country and cities. The cost of these classes varies, but they generally cost a reasonable amount. They are also an excellent opportunity to understand more about motorcycles as well as road rules.


License Requirements

There are certain requirements for riding a motorcycle. This includes obtaining an active driver's license and undergoing an eye test, and passing a road skills test. Many states require that motorcyclists carry insurance on their bikes. The specifics of these requirements may differ from state to state, which is why it is important to study prior to beginning the licensing process.

The first step for those who want to get a license for a motorcycle is to visit the local DMV. You will need to provide evidence of your age and identity, as well as other documents. This typically includes the passport or birth certificate or any other government-issued photo identification. You may need to provide evidence that you're a resident, for example, an utility bill or a rental agreement. In addition, you'll have to pay any fees applicable to you.

Most new drivers must pass an exam in writing before they can get their license. These tests cover the fundamentals of driving as well as traffic laws and safety rules. These tests are designed to help novice drivers gain confidence behind the wheels and reduce their risk of being involved in a crash.

After passing the written test, it's time to take a road test. The test format is different from a standard driver’s license since a motorcycle examiner cannot supervise you from the front seat. When you take the road skills test an examiner will look at your ability to maneuver your bike through a closed-course or another secluded area. You'll be assessed on how well you can accelerate, brake, and turn.

Before you take your road skills test, it's recommended to practice riding as much as you can using your learner's permit. The majority of states require riders under the age of 18 to be supervised by another rider with a full license while they're practicing. This supervising rider must remain visible and within a quarter-mile radius of the learning rider at all times, and they must also have a minimum of 30 hours of experience riding at least 10 of which must be in moderate or heavy traffic. Fees

The process of getting your motorcycle driver's license isn't cheap and it's important to understand the cost involved to make a sound choice regarding your options for training. Whether you are taking a course to waive the road test or already have a driver's license, there is still a cost for the process. The following sections delve into the various fees and accepted payment methods to help you navigate the financial aspects of getting your license.

The first step in obtaining your license is to apply for a learner's permit. This permits you to use a motorcycle from dawn until dusk but you must always be with an adult. The permit is priced at $12 and is valid for one year. You can also enroll in the basic rider's course to cut down the amount of time you'll need to practice your permit.

Once you have your permit, you are able to take an exam on the road and earn an MJ or Class M license. You must be at least 16 years old and have taken a test for three months before you can take your test. Additionally, if you receive any citations in the course of your practice, you'll need to wait until the violation expires before scheduling your road test. The road tests are administered by the New York State Department of Motor Vehicles.

If you want to upgrade your license from a Class M or MJ license to an Enhanced license, you will have to pay a fee of $30. The enhanced license permits you to travel via water or land to Canada, Mexico and Bermuda. It can also serve as proof of U.S. Citizenship, which is useful in certain situations.

You can pay cash, or with a cash or money order made payable to the Commissioner for Motor Vehicles. The majority of DMV offices accept debit or credit cards too, but the exact amount you must pay will be contingent on your age and location. Check the official website of your local DMV for exact figures.
